What to do if this happened to you
- 1
Call 911 — you need a police report and medical attention.
- 2
If you can, take photos and get the driver's and witnesses' information.
- 3
Don't argue about fault at the scene.
- 4
Keep your damaged clothing and belongings — they're evidence.
- 5
Talk to an attorney before dealing with any insurance company.
